2010-04-13 27 views
23

Ống gần đây bị lỗi và đã ngừng tiết kiệm ống mới trong những ngày này. Google Mashup Editor và Microsoft Popfly đều bị ngừng hoạt động. Có bất kỳ ứng dụng web hiện đang chạy nào (hoặc ít nhất các thư viện chạy trên appengine) thực hiện điều gì đó tương tự không?Có cách nào khác thay thế cho Yahoo Pipes không?

+0

trùng lặp: http://stackoverflow.com/questions/2019887/alternatives-to-yahoo-pipes –

+4

không trùng lặp: đó là về "các lựa chọn thay thế đang chạy trên máy chủ của riêng tôi" –

Trả lời

10

(Câu hỏi này đã được hỏi nhiều lần ... n Ví dụ: Yahoo Pipes clone script? Alternatives to Yahoo Pipes )

Pipe2py là một kịch bản trình biên dịch sẽ tạo ra một tương đương Python của một ống Yahoo cho URL của ống :

https://github.com/ggaughan/pipe2py/

(Lưu ý rằng không phải tất cả Ống khối vẫn chưa được triển khai.)

A "tổ chức" phiên bản của Pipe2Py cũng có sẵn trên Google App Engine: http://pipes-engine.appspot.com/

Bạn cũng có thể tìm thấy YQL [http://developer.yahoo.com/yql/console/] và Scraperwiki [http://scraperwiki.com/] hữu ích

+2

Chắc chắn nó có nhưng trong tương lai liên quan đến ngày tôi đăng câu hỏi này. Hãy kiểm tra ngày tháng. Cảm ơn câu trả lời, không trớ trêu :) – sri

5

Dapper có vẻ khá tốt, không linh hoạt nhưng dễ phân tích dữ liệu hơn.

+1

người xem có vẻ như nó có thể thực hiện công việc. cám ơn. – sri

+3

dapper cũng dường như được sở hữu/điều hành bởi yahoo - không chắc chắn làm thế nào điều này sẽ là một thay thế thích hợp – messedup

+0

@messedup: Không chắc chắn tại sao downvote, Dapper đã được mua lại bởi Yahoo! vào ngày 05 tháng 10 năm 2010 (http://www.dapper.net/news/?p=1208), một vài tháng sau khi tôi viết bài này. –

2

thử YQL, Yahoo! Ngôn ngữ truy vấn.

2

Kiểm tra http://superfeedr.com/ Không giống như đường ống vì nó không lưu bất kỳ dữ liệu nào, nhưng bạn có thể dễ dàng xác định luồng công việc nơi dữ liệu từ nguồn cấp dữ liệu được đẩy tới bạn.

0

Các unstopable 'nâng cấp' để verion II của YP đang gây ra nhiều vấn đề hơn, hy vọng nó sẽ sớm ổn định. Trang web của tôi đã ngừng hoạt động.

Đang trong quá trình tạo lại đường ống của mình bằng PYTHON trên Google Apps Engine, nó không thân thiện như ống nhưng phải ổn định hơn. Rất giống với PHP nguyên nhưng với quirks sublte và chắc chắn không dành cho người mới bắt đầu. Tôi khá hợp lý với php và tìm đường cong học tập dốc, nhưng không có gì đáng tin cậy ngoài kia.

0

Tôi đã sử dụng Yahoo Pipes để có thể yêu cầu nguồn cấp dữ liệu RSS từ các trang web khác sử dụng AJAX.

Hiện tại, Ống không hoạt động, tôi đã sử dụng cors-anywhere để phát triển proxy riêng của mình. Nó sẽ đưa bạn 10-15 phút để có được phiên bản của riêng bạn đã sẵn sàng. Bạn có thể tìm thấy triển khai của tôi here

Khi bạn đã sẵn sàng trong kho lưu trữ GitHub, bạn có thể triển khai repo từ Github tới Azure chỉ trong 5 phút sau this tutorial.

Sau đó, bạn sẽ có thể yêu cầu một cấp dữ liệu thông qua ajax, ví dụ:

http://stackoverflow.com/feeds/user/606821 

Có thể được yêu cầu sử dụng:

http://my-cors-proxy.azurewebsites.net/stackoverflow.com/feeds/user/606821 

Lưu ý: Bạn chỉ cần thay thế trang web của xanh URL của riêng bạn:

http://my-cors-proxy.azurewebsites.net/

URL ở trên chỉ có thể được gọi từ remojansen.com vì nó được cấu hình theo cách mà sử dụng cài đặt cors-anywhereoriginWhitelist:

originWhitelist: (process.env.PORT ? ['http://www.remojansen.com'] : []), 

Tôi hy vọng câu trả lời của tôi sẽ giúp một số người có vấn đề của tôi.

Các vấn đề liên quan